Study On Algorithm Solution And Control Method Of Dynamic Balance Test Machine

Tyre dynamic balance test machine is important equipment to test tyre mass distribution; it is used for measuring tyre upper plane imbalance quantity with its angle, lower plane imbalance quantity with its angle, static imbalance quantity and its angle, couple imbalance with its angle. Through analyzing force reaction of tyre imbalance, multisensormeasuring method is established for tyre dynamic balance test machine, by which a set of mathematic models is established to calculate tyre imbalance quantity. With the study on calibration principle, extended least square method is introduced here with the purpose of giving the coefficient parameters of the mathematic model.Data acquisition and DSP method is study in this paper. Through Analysis on input signal of data acquisition PCI, data signal can be sure to be valid. Based on study on discrete data signal, filtering algorithm that includes low pass filtering and band-pass filtering is applied in tyre dynamic balance test machine. According to Fourier transposition, Fourier spectral analysis algorithm has realized.Host computer management system software is developed based on Delphi. This software provides functions such as filtering, spectral analyzing, calculating imbalance quantity, quantity calibrating, core shift compensating, and zero calibrating. Multi thread method and Ethernet communication are applied as part of this software. This software also includes tyre specification management, database management, report management, history data query, trouble-shooting and so on. This system adopt web as method of remote access. All of this realizes integration of management and control idea, and informatization idea.
